Mark and Sharon are standing side by side. Then, Mark begins walking N45°E at a speed of 1.6 m/s. Sharon starts walking at the same time, at a speed of 1.3 m/s, in the direction S60°E. If they are about 106.8 m apart after one minute, about how far apart are they after another minute of walking at the same speed and in the same direction?
  1. 184.8 m
  2. 202.8 m
  3. 213.6 m
  4. 280.8 m
